Unveiling the Business Ecstasy of Ruby on Rails Development
With ever-improving software development, choosing the most resilient and efficient technology is critical to the success of any organization. Ruby on Rails (RoR) is an appealing solution for software and product development firms seeking a dynamic and adaptable approach. RoR has become a cornerstone for enterprises looking to shorten their development cycles and enhance productivity due to its extensive syntax, custom-focused mindset, and lively developer community. Ruby on Rails’ fundamental promise is to streamline the development process with custom rather than programming, drastically decreasing the time spent doing repeated operations. We investigate the several performance advantages that Ruby on Rails brings to the forefront, particularly rules ranging from rapid expansion to cost efficiency. In addition to quality, RoR development company looks to be a stimulant for innovation, allowing enterprises to negotiate the competitive landscape more aggressively and high-quality software products to reach the market faster.
A High-Level Exploration of Ruby on Rails’ Transformative Business Advantages
One of the primary reasons software businesses select Ruby on Rails is that it promotes assembly over code. This means that RoR has compatibility and default presets to make the development process easier. Developers can concentrate on writing unique areas of code, reducing the time spent on repetitive operations dramatically. This enables enterprises to get their software solutions to market faster by allowing for shorter development cycles. Ruby on Rails provides substantial advantages in a competitive setting where time to market is critical. RoR development Companies may stay ahead of the curve and respond rapidly to market demands by reacting quickly and adjusting to changing needs.
Efficiency is about more than simply speed; it is also about consumption. Ruby on Rails allows developers to accomplish more with less code, which reduces overall development effort. A custom-based approach, along with a broad ecosystem of open-source resources (libraries), allows developers to utilize existing solutions, saving time and creating functionality from scratch with ease. Furthermore, RoR’s modular architecture and the availability of reusable materials contribute to a more efficient development process for many. This modular approach not only improves code control but also allows for easy collaboration across development teams. As a result, software companies can meet their objectives through cost-effective distribution.
The Intricate Business Dynamics Enhanced by Ruby on Rails
Scalability is an important consideration for software product development organizations seeking long-term success. Ruby on Rails is built with scalability in mind, allowing applications to grow in sync with user demand. The framework includes tools and best practices for dealing with scalability issues, making it easier to upgrade and grow applications without sacrificing performance. RoR’s adaptability is also obvious in its support for numerous programming paradigms. Developers can employ both procedural and object-oriented programming techniques, giving them the flexibility they need to meet a variety of project needs. This adaptability is crucial for software product development firms working on a variety of projects with varying needs and specifications. Maintaining and updating apps over time is as vital as initial development for organizations developing software goods. Ruby on Rails encourages clean code and adheres to the DRY (Don’t Repeat Yourself) concept, which emphasizes code reuse and structure. As a result, codebases are simple to comprehend, maintain, and extend.
RSpec and Capybara, two framework-integrated testing tools, encourage the usage of test-driven development (TDD) approaches. This strategy not only ensures that the coding is resilient and error-free, but also makes it easy to implement new features and upgrades without interfering with existing functionality. This translates into long-term cost savings and sustainable development plans for RoR development companies. A development framework’s power is frequently found in its community and environment. Ruby on Rails has a powerful and friendly development community that actively contributes to its evolution. This community-driven approach ensures that the framework is kept up to date with the newest trends and technologies, giving software development firms a solid base for their projects. The rich ecosystem of Ruby gems and libraries extends RoR’s capabilities even further. These pre-built components provide a wide range of functions, including authentication and authorization, payment processing, and data storage. Using these gems speeds up development and decreases error risk, thus improving the overall robustness of the software product.
A Strategic Odyssey into Elevated Business Performance
Choosing the correct technology stack in a dynamic software product development environment is a strategic decision that can have a substantial impact on a company’s performance. Ruby on Rails has shown to be a dependable and practical framework, offering numerous commercial advantages to firms in this field. RoR provides a robust platform for producing innovative and competitive software solutions, from rapid development and cost efficiency to scalability and maintainability. We as a Software product development company offer Ruby on Rails for short-term and long-term objectives. Join hands! For an exceptional partnership.